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Ubud to Kendari is to bus and ferry which costs Rp1000000 - Rp1600000 and takes 3 days 0h.
The fastest way to get from Ubud to Kendari is to fly which takes 7h 1m and costs Rp2000000 - Rp2700000.
The distance between Ubud and Kendari is 1010 km.
The best way to get from Ubud to Kendari without a car is to bus and train and ferry which takes 2 days 22h and costs Rp1100000 - Rp1700000.
It takes approximately 7h 1m to get from Ubud to Kendari, including transfers.
